Default Rules for the RPG

General Rules

- Be friendly and compromise with other rpers. An rpg can't work if every participant is constantly at each others' throats.

- Be realistic and considerate when making battle posts. No character is invincible, so don't make it seem that way.

- You cannot kill another rper's character without permission.

- Label threads according to content.

- "Private" threads' storylines are thought up in advance, so don't join one unless the posters give you permission and you know where the plot is headed. All threads not marked as private are open, so don't be afraid to post!

- Please don't make multiple usernames and start rping with yourself just to make it seem like you're a badass, because you're not.

- Posts must be at least 3 sentences in length, or at least 75 words total.

- If you see a violation of any of these rules by another rper, then please report him/her to The_Heroic_Loser, SpØkelse, or Ikin via private message.

Game-Specific Rules

- Characters can have one power. They may have multiple powers only if the powers are related closely enough to actually be considered one power (i.e. Hiro's teleportation and time manipulation could be considered as one power: bending the space/time continuum).

- Think of a power that would be able to exist in the Heroes world. This should be easy if you have seen the show before.

- These are powers that are banned from the rpg (subject to change):
Power absorption/mimicry (limited power mimicry is allowed, but only for veteran rpers)
Reality manipulation
Absorption of all forms of energy
Complete mind-control (limited mind-control is allowed, as long as you don't go overboard and start godmodding)
Omnipotence (Or "all powers")

- You must specify if your character is a hero, villain, or neutral. However, over time, your character can switch to another side if you wish.

- Characters cannot exist in different location threads at the same time, unless they are in the present storyline and in an alternate universe storyline.

NEWEST

-No cybercasts may be used from the show itself. (ex. Zachary Quinto, Hayden)

This is a little background on the powers of the characters on Heroes, via member Karambit:

The premise of the show is people experiencing extraordinary abilities. However, it has laid out a set of rules regarding these abilities.

Only one ability unless that power allows other extraordinary abilities. One can not read someones mind AND use telekinesis unless they are a power mimic or can steal powers.
The Haitian is a prime example for multiple powers. His ability is memory manipulation. He can wipe your memory and he subconciously makes you forget how to use your power. However, extreme concentration can override this.
Niki is extremely strong, but that doesn't mean she can jump really high or move at superhumans speeds. Her power as it stands is simply being able apply more force than is physically possible.

That ability must be simple.
Matt'sTelepathy doesn't mean mental conversation, it means being able to get inside peoples heads. He can hear what people think. In the future this was honed to being able to pull information of any kind.

Powers can be explained. This does not always mean scientific sense, sometimes it makes sense in a metaphysical way.
Peter has "empathic power mimicry." This means that by feeling for someone Peter connects with them. This empathic connection makes him alter his genetic makeup resulting in power mimicry. "Empathy" isn't defined as knowing another person's feelings, it's defined as emotions. He uses emotions to make a connection. Once that emotional connection is made he can use the same emotion to unlock the ability. If he's scared he'll opt for telekinesis because fear is the emotion he felt when meeting Sylar.
Nathan can fly. This means that he can levitate and move at any speed he desires and normal laws of physics don't apply.
Claude can become invisible. If normal laws of the universe held true Claude should not be able to see. Instead, he can see but no one sees him.

Unless a power specifically crosses science then it can be explained scientifically.
Nathan can fly at any speed because his power is flight. All science that applies is thrown out the window. Same with Claude.
Teddy Sprague can not simply make himself explode. His power is induced radioactivity, which means he emits radiation. Such a power allows him to become a walking nuclear warhead. Because he emits it, the laws of science applying to radiation do not apply to him. He can not be poisoned by radiation and blowing himself up will not harm him.
Claire Bennet has a super-fast healing process. Her body regenerates so quickly normally unsurvivable things such as falling or being stabbed aren't around long enough to cause permanent problems. According to this she was not actually dead on the autopsy table. She appears dead because her mind is disconnected from her body. Her power was still working keeping her brain alive without blood flow. Had she received a CAT scan her brain would have appeared active. She has no memory of being dead as her mind and body were disconnected.

Abilities are affected by the subconscious mind.
Niki can only use her power when the Jessica personality of her DID was active. She later resolved this and her power is not affected by it.
Hiro and Peter could not control their powers because they lacked self-confidence. The Future versions of these two seemed to have gained self-confidence from repeated use of the power.
Claire consciously wishes to not have the ability. She still has the ability.

These rules applied:

Weather Manipulation can be a power as it is a single ability. However, it would probably not allow electrokinesis. More like you could make a giant thunderstorm appear and lightening would strike at random.
Particle Manipulation (subatomic particle control) can allow just about everything because the way it is described is basically psychokinesis minus the telekinesis crossover.
Electricity Manipulation can allow a great number of superhuman abilities simply because electricity affects many things.

Pyrokinesis does not allow someone to become or fly using fire.
Hydrokinesis would allow control of water in all three of its forms, steam liquid and ice. However, one could not make it into a different form or generate it.
Ice Generation can not allow you to make yourself of ice. However, you would be immune to cold. You could encase yourself in ice indefinitely as long as you can breath.
